Q: If the electric potential at a point is increased from 5 V to 15 V, what is the change in potential energy of a charge of 3 C placed at that point?
Solution:
Change in potential energy ΔU = qΔV = 3 C × (15 V - 5 V) = 30 J.

Step 1: Identify the initial electric potential, which is 5 V.
Step 2: Identify the final electric potential, which is 15 V.
Step 3: Calculate the change in electric potential (ΔV) by subtracting the initial potential from the final potential: ΔV = 15 V - 5 V.
Step 4: Calculate ΔV, which equals 10 V.
Step 5: Identify the charge (q) placed at that point, which is 3 C.
Step 6: Use the formula for change in potential energy (ΔU), which is ΔU = q × ΔV.
Step 7: Substitute the values into the formula: ΔU = 3 C × 10 V.
Step 8: Calculate the change in potential energy: ΔU = 30 J.
